"matras" meaning in French

See matras in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

IPA: /ma.tʁa/, /ma.tʁɑ/ Audio: LL-Q150 (fra)-WikiLucas00-matras.wav
Etymology: Borrowed from Provençal matrat (“arrow”), from Old French matras, from Latin matara, materis, madaris (“Celtic javelin”), a word of Celtic/Gaulish origin. Doublet of matras. Etymology: Borrowed from Arabic مَطَرَة (maṭara, “leather bag”). Etymology templates: {{bor+|fr|ar|مَطَرَة|gloss=leather bag}} Borrowed from Arabic مَطَرَة (maṭara, “leather bag”) Head templates: {{fr-noun|m}} matras m (invariable)
  1. an alchemist's long-necked glass receiver Tags: invariable, masculine
